The Grand Family Suite is situated on the 2nd story (no elevator) of Arizona's Oldest Hotel, built in 1891. It encompasses what used to be three separate rooms and now has a king bedroom, a queen bunkbed room, a foyer, living room, and bathroom. As the largest suite in all the hotel, it has a mini fridge, smart tv with HBO, Netflix, Disney+, and a smattering of live channels via Vizio TV. Shared with other guests, there is a Victorian inspired library on site. The Hotel, just one hour from the South Rim of the Grand Canyon, sits on famed route 66 and 2nd St, surrounded by shopping, local eateries, and just minutes from Bearizona, a North American Wildlife Zoo.
